Hamilton Bowmancatalogued 1938-194014K yellow gold filled case17-jewel 980 movementapplied gold numeral dial only22mm x 38mm case size16mm strap widthSimilar case style to the solid gold Bentley, the Bowman is one of the few Hamilton models to have a round sub-second register in a rectangular case. The lug design is unusual and also shared with the Bentleyparison with Hamilton Bentley
